Biologist, specialist in remote sensing image interpretation applied to rural studies; with a Master’s degree in Biological Sciences (Biodiversity and Conservation focus) from the National University of Colombia, and currently a PhD candidate in the same program and university. Experience focused on the planning and management of protected areas, as well as the formulation of policies, strategies, and planning instruments for biodiversity conservation and sustainable use. Professional activities developed through advisory services, training, collaboration with institutions and with rural and ethnic communities, workshops with technical teams, and the generation and analysis of information aimed at conservation, for both private companies and government institutions. Member of the IUCN World Commission on Protected Areas. Advisor to National Natural Parks of Colombia on different management issues since 2006. Deputy Director of Management and Administration since February 2024.
